Section 56(2)(ix) addition on alleged forfeited advance was held unsustainable because the amount received was not an "advance" for transfer of a capital asset but reimbursement/recovery of amounts earlier paid on behalf of the payer; the statutory precondition of receipt of advance was not met, so the addition was deleted. Disallowance under section 57 was rejected since the assessee had disclosed bank interest income and the bank transaction charges were incurred for earning such income and were supported by details; the deduction was allowed. Capital gains computation was corrected as the AO restricted cost of acquisition without reasons or breakup; full claimed cost was accepted, resulting in the declared capital loss being allowed. - ITAT
